上QQ阅读APP看书,第一时间看更新
012 解决异常情况
当用户操作不当时,小程序页面可能会出现一些异常情况。虽然这不是小程序自身的过错,但是异常情况仍是一个必须解决的问题。因为遇到异常情况之后,用户多少会有些茫然,如果小程序不能为用户提供解决方案,那么,用户很可能会由于无法正常使用某些功能而退出,甚至是删除小程序。
因此,运营者在设计小程序页面时,必须要做好异常情况的解决工作。具体来说,异常情况的解决需要做两方面的工作:一是告知异常情况,二是提供解决方案。
图1-44为微信官网给出的表单报错示例,在该页面以“表单报错”为标题,并显示“卡号格式不正确”,同时卡号也变成了红色。经过这一处理,用户便能清楚地获知具体异常情况以及解决方案。
除了表单报错之外,运营者还可以通过温馨提示对话框的设置帮用户解决异常情况。图1-45所示为某小程序中的温馨提示对话框,在该对话框中,明确指出“输入的图形验证码有误”,与此同时还提供了“重新输入”的解决方案。这样一来,用户看到该对话框之后便可自行解决异常情况。
图1-44 表单报错
图1-45 温馨提示对话框